Story: Dirty Game - Season 1 - Episode 49

I took the letter to my sister and his husband when I couldn’t reason on the way out and they were also shocked when they went through it and got the content of the letter.
Though, it was not that strange to my sister, but it got her husband lost which made him went crisome and lashed me with irritating words without minding my present status and that, I was also a father. My sister couldn’t utter a word because she dare not say anything when the man is around while I bowed my head in acceptance of the defeat…
“You are not trustworthy and I’m totally disappointed in you. In fact, we have to leave you to dance to the beat of the trouble you have played” he said angrily and flung the letter while he left us on seat and worked briskly into his room.
I never expected such reaction from him and his reaction gave me the instinct of the strength and the intensity of the offence I committed…
******
I brushed my hair with my volar to and fro when my eyes were filled with tears and I nearly busted into tears which made my sister moved closer to pet me, “all is well dear. Don’t worry, I will speak to him and justice will be done to it”, she said and went in to join him…
I couldn’t get myself right throughout that day not until the following day when the man called on me, sat me down and fed me with words of virtue and we later sketched out the plan on how to go about the issue…
My sister was asked to monitor the home while her husband and I went to Ede in order to see Zainab’s family. We called on Demola, who also informed his father about the scenario and we all went there together.
******
The elders that we consulted during Taiwo’s issue were met and they told us that only Zainab’s father could tell us about Zainab and he was still in hospital and promised to keep us informed when he is alright. In fact, I couldn’t just believe they could be lenient and so generous to us on such issue.
We appreciated them and left the place. Demola’s father also gave us hope about the issue due to his relationship with Zainab’s father.
The following week, I got a call from my boss to come but it was not urgent. I prepared for the journey and informed my sister. Though, her husband was not around, but I managed to put the call to him as well so as to get him informed about my movement.
******
When I was about to enter Ore town, then I remember that I carried a man to one hospital and my mind asked me to check on him to know about his welfare, but I rejected it and zoomed off to my destination.
My boss and colleagues sympathized with me on the issue of my wife and asked about the twins which I also thanked them for showing concern and for their supports through text messages and calls.
It was a great challenge for me to get over the issue most especially when I thought about Taiwo’s words in the letter and the emphasis she made on Zainab’s issue. Assuming I was opportuned to get in touch with Zainab, will she forgive me? If she does, what about her rigid father who has lost Taiwo through me and almost lost his life in the process of checking on her? When I thought about those questions, my heart vibrated and I was tired of myself.
As day goes over day, I started getting over my troubled mind when I mixed with my people at work because they were all friendly and jovial.
I never let go of anyday without putting calls to my sister and asked about how the kids doing.
******
One Saturday evening, around 9:15pm, I was in bed and about to sleep when I heard my phone ringing and when I looked at the screen, it happened to be a strange number which I pick without any delay…
“Hello o, who is this?” I curiously asked.
“This is Dr. Apan. Am I speaking with Mr. Afeez?” he asked calmly.
“You are very much on his line. Any problem?” I intoned without fear.
“Good! Thanks for the other day. In fact, more of your type are needed in our society. Here is the chief you saved his life and he is interested in speaking with you” he said (trying to handle the phone to the man)
******
“hello Mr. Man, how are you doing?” he intoned in big man voice.
“I’m very much okay sir. How is your body now sir?” I responded
“I’m now very much okay and I will be discharged probably tomorrow. Thanks so much. I really appreciate you and I will like to know you” He said and requested.
“I’m very happy to hear this sir. You are my father sir, and therefore command me which ever way you like it sir”, I replied.
“You are blessed. That’s my number, I will get you inform when I’m available. Thanks alot”, he said.
“Alright sir”, I replied and he hung up the call…
